My Phuket hotel has just received some new guests who were driven by minibus from BKK to Phuket, due to the closure of the BKK airports. There were 5 minibuses in a 'convoy' and 1 crashed during the journey. Apparently 2 tourists died and the rest were injured.

I have no other details of the nationalities and extent of the injuries. But someone's holiday in Thailand has turned to tragedy.
